SUCI protests against ‘repression’ in Nandigram

Staff Correspondent



IN PROTEST: Members of the Socialist Unity Centre of India staging a demonstration in Bijapur on Tuesday.

BIJAPUR: Members of the Socialist Unity Centre of India (SUCI) staged a demonstration at Gandhi Chowk in Bijapur on Tuesday protesting against the “repression” of public agitation in Nandigram, by the Communist Party of India (Marxist) led Government in West Bengal.

The SUCI took strong exception to the CPM’s dual policy on Special Economic Zones (SEZ).

B. Bhagwan Reddy, district convener of the SUCI, who led the protest, accused the CPM and CPI of pursuing dual policies on economic liberalisation and foreign investment.

The Left parties had been giving a red carpet welcome to capitalists in West Bengal and Kerala, but opposing the same in other parts of the country. Because of this, both parties had lost their reputation. They would be defeated in the next elections, he said.

The members also condemned the firing incidents in Nandigram. SUCI office-bearers H.T. Bharatkumar, Deepti Devkate and Mallikarjun spoke.
